没有定义width的浮动block元素总是出现不自动换行的BUG ,找了很多,也试了很多,唯一下面的方法比较完美,很简单,就是一个属性,
把该block元素的CSS 中加入:
white-space:nowrap;
这一句
注:
white-space:nowrap;
width:100pa;
火狐下 必须定义 宽度 和高度
比如:
div{white-space: nowrap;}
运行代码无着色模式复制打印?
现在介绍一下white-space:nowrap简单语法
white-space 属性设置如何处理元素内的空白。
这个属性声明建立布局过程中如何处理元素中的空白符。值 pre-wrap 和 pre-line 是 CSS 2.1 中新增的。
默认值: | normal |
---|---|
继承性: | yes |
版本: | CSS1 |
JavaScript 语法: | object.style.whiteSpace="pre" |